I see that everyone's favourite member of the "MPs Least Likely to Win Mastermind Club", Nadine Dorries, has put her foot in it again. 

From The Independent... 

"Former culture secretary Nadine Dorries has been accused by Parliament’s anti-corruption watchdog of breaking Government rules by not consulting the body before taking a new job at TalkTV.

Ms Dorries will host a new Friday-night talk show on TalkTV but in a letter to the Conservative MP the Advisory Committee on Business Appointments (Acoba) chair Lord Pickles said “failing to seek and await advice before the role was announced or taken up in this case is a breach of the Government’s rules and the requirements set out in the ministerial code”.

Seemingly no further action will be taken though. Again, from the same source... 

"In a separate letter to Chancellor of the Duchy of Lancaster Oliver Dowden, Lord Pickles recommended that “given the transparent nature” of the role, it would be “disproportionate to take any further action in this case. 

However, he added that the case was a “further illustration of how out of date the Government’s rules are”.
